The Application Process

Applying for a license in Denmark includes numerous actions that should be diligently followed, depending on the kind of license being sought. Here is a basic summary of the application procedures for some essential licenses:

Business License

  • Step 1: Register your company with the Danish Business Authority (Erhvervsstyrelsen).
  • Action 2: Ensure compliance with regional and national regulations.
  • Action 3: Complete the application kind readily available online.
  • Step 4: Submit required documents and costs.

Expert License

  • Action 1: Verify if your occupation is controlled in Denmark.
  • Action 2: Submit evidence of qualifications and experience to the pertinent authority.
  • Step 3: Complete any essential evaluations if needed.
  • Step 4: Await confirmation of your license approval.

Chauffeur's License

  • Step 1: Obtain a theory and useful assessment from a licensed driving school.
  • Step 2: Fill out the application kind supplied by the DMV (Motorstyrelsen).
  • Step 3: Provide recognition and proof of home.
  • Step 4: Pay the license fee.

Import/Export License

  • Step 1: Register your service and obtain a VAT number.
  • Action 2: Identify the goods and ensure compliance with international trade regulations.
  • Action 3: Apply through the Danish Customs and Tax Administration.
  • Step 4: Submit relevant documentation such as custom-mades declarations.

Alcohol License

  • Action 1: Develop a business plan that consists of the sale of alcohol.
  • Action 2: Consult the local municipality for specific requirements.
  • Step 3: Fill out the application for an alcohol license.
  • Step 4: Provide a character recommendation and any other necessary documents.
